Commit Graph

  • 39c45abc38 mu-store: use Mu::MessageContact Dirk-Jan C. Binnema 2022-02-19 19:00:47 +02:00
  • 6a7e706354 guile: use Mu::MessageContact Dirk-Jan C. Binnema 2022-02-19 18:59:42 +02:00
  • 3aa053e158 mu-msg: use Mu::MessageContact Dirk-Jan C. Binnema 2022-02-19 18:57:50 +02:00
  • d436a47c1f lib: Implement Mu::MessageContact Dirk-Jan C. Binnema 2022-02-19 11:55:31 +02:00
  • 69a465d849 mu-sexp: add some small conveniences Dirk-Jan C. Binnema 2022-02-19 19:00:19 +02:00
  • be2f91c0ad build: update autotools build Dirk-Jan C. Binnema 2022-02-19 19:32:02 +02:00
  • 4f81f04d24 toys/mug: fix compilation Dirk-Jan C. Binnema 2022-02-19 19:31:37 +02:00
  • 1a13e4f0fd mu-message-priority: set namespace correctly Dirk-Jan C. Binnema 2022-02-19 19:16:49 +02:00
  • 8cea933a51 mu-store: take mu_util_get_hash Dirk-Jan C. Binnema 2022-02-19 19:09:25 +02:00
  • 286badf802 build: bump warning level to 2 Dirk-Jan C. Binnema 2022-02-18 10:52:41 +02:00
  • c0da564bba lib: fix clang compatibility / warnings Dirk-Jan C. Binnema 2022-02-18 10:49:56 +02:00
  • d2e6cfdf70 build: update Makefile.meson with some useful targets Dirk-Jan C. Binnema 2022-02-18 07:11:18 +02:00
  • fe2b1693c1 lib/message-flags: update whitespace & clang++ appeasement Dirk-Jan C. Binnema 2022-02-18 07:10:31 +02:00
  • 0f87cedb77 build: bump version to 1.7.8 Dirk-Jan C. Binnema 2022-02-16 18:30:21 +02:00
  • 169921fd21 mu: improve help text generation Dirk-Jan C. Binnema 2022-02-17 23:48:15 +02:00
  • 80f947024a server: lock run_query Dirk-Jan C. Binnema 2022-02-17 23:46:44 +02:00
  • 831d26052a store: expose the mutex so we can lock query-results Dirk-Jan C. Binnema 2022-02-17 23:45:04 +02:00
  • 4eabf1a64a *: update for for mu-maildir changes Dirk-Jan C. Binnema 2022-02-16 23:03:48 +02:00
  • abd2a4a8f1 lib: Update mu-maildir for modern times Dirk-Jan C. Binnema 2022-02-16 22:59:03 +02:00
  • 1db70c05e6 utils/async-queue: appease helgrind Dirk-Jan C. Binnema 2022-02-16 22:13:05 +02:00
  • d2a75f600d tickle: remove Dirk-Jan C. Binnema 2022-02-16 22:07:40 +02:00
  • f6f17d5d6b *: update code for Mu::MessageFlags Dirk-Jan C. Binnema 2022-02-16 22:06:00 +02:00
  • 473134a7b1 lib: replace MuFlags with Mu::MessageFlags Dirk-Jan C. Binnema 2022-02-16 21:56:02 +02:00
  • c5538d5b14 utils: update optional & expected Dirk-Jan C. Binnema 2022-02-16 21:52:43 +02:00
  • bc44666d88 mu-str: Remove some dead code Dirk-Jan C. Binnema 2022-02-15 22:30:52 +02:00
  • dce924da9c mu-error: Better support for GError Dirk-Jan C. Binnema 2022-02-15 22:28:21 +02:00
  • 80cbf7c75b utils: Improve Mu::Result Dirk-Jan C. Binnema 2022-02-15 22:24:28 +02:00
  • 6ff1831200 utils: make MU_ENABLE_BITOPS more constexpr Dirk-Jan C. Binnema 2022-02-14 11:12:38 +02:00
  • 3086238b33 store: expose metadata()/set_metadata() Dirk-Jan C. Binnema 2022-02-13 15:22:09 +02:00
  • 3820118246 store: rename "metadata" into "properties" Dirk-Jan C. Binnema 2022-02-13 14:52:41 +02:00
  • 23fc8bdba8 update code for Mu::MessagePriority Dirk-Jan C. Binnema 2022-02-13 14:32:10 +02:00
  • 13bcc6eb5d lib: replace MuMsgPrio with Mu::MessagePriority Dirk-Jan C. Binnema 2022-02-13 14:23:09 +02:00
  • 5fbebbff86 tweak coding style / configuration Dirk-Jan C. Binnema 2022-02-13 12:05:08 +02:00
  • a0ec982789 mu4e/server: honor rename-move for view-message, too Dirk-Jan C. Binnema 2022-02-13 12:03:16 +02:00
  • a66fd4dae4 mu4e-headers: warn earlier when message does not exist Dirk-Jan C. Binnema 2022-02-10 23:40:18 +02:00
  • 43c44cf6cd store: catch dtor exception Dirk-Jan C. Binnema 2022-02-07 22:34:49 +02:00
  • ea3083da2e mu: config: fix leak Dirk-Jan C. Binnema 2022-02-07 22:13:58 +02:00
  • 9b77a12db7 mu: cmd-index: make signal-handler thread-safe Dirk-Jan C. Binnema 2022-02-07 22:01:11 +02:00
  • 18ddbe06e6 indexer: fix some threading issues with Progress Dirk-Jan C. Binnema 2022-02-07 20:49:43 +02:00
  • a628f214a1 index: fix thread-sanitizer issue Dirk-Jan C. Binnema 2022-02-07 18:03:53 +02:00
  • e818e94d0e build: fix some scan-build warnings Dirk-Jan C. Binnema 2022-02-07 17:36:34 +02:00
  • 8493e8649d mu-utils: try g_autoptr/g_autofree Dirk-Jan C. Binnema 2022-02-06 12:28:18 +02:00
  • d0a3ca3453 utils: validate string before g_utf8_next_char() Zero King 2021-12-25 13:28:43 +00:00
  • c3503ba663 server: flush the "indexing complete" message Dirk-Jan C. Binnema 2022-02-06 14:17:42 +02:00
  • 3f163e65e0 update NEWS.org Dirk-Jan C. Binnema 2022-02-06 11:16:46 +02:00
  • 99993bea69 mu4e-headers: tweak mark-as-orphan option Dirk-Jan C. Binnema 2022-02-06 10:44:47 +02:00
  • 769ad20c40 Merge pull request #2203 from mhcerri/mu4e-headers-thread-mark-as-orphan Dirk-Jan C. Binnema 2022-02-06 10:41:28 +02:00
  • 77bca5463f store: don't lock for_each_term Dirk-Jan C. Binnema 2022-02-05 08:44:43 +02:00
  • 6becc657c1 build: bump version to 1.7.7 Dirk-Jan C. Binnema 2022-01-30 14:39:36 +02:00
  • 6dafffd07a mu4e-server: tweak stopping the mu4e server Dirk-Jan C. Binnema 2022-02-03 23:02:44 +02:00
  • 4d0ecf7f85 server: make indexing asynchronous Dirk-Jan C. Binnema 2022-02-03 22:59:47 +02:00
  • b6d7d142f6 server: support flushing the output Dirk-Jan C. Binnema 2022-02-03 22:58:53 +02:00
  • 05393ba797 index: save/commit metadata after messages Dirk-Jan C. Binnema 2022-02-03 22:51:02 +02:00
  • 12658a3dc6 cmd-server: improve signal handling Dirk-Jan C. Binnema 2022-01-30 14:34:10 +02:00
  • ebc9b88f80 store/query: update for new store/query api Dirk-Jan C. Binnema 2022-01-30 14:33:25 +02:00
  • 5fc8a8f83e store/query: access query only through store Dirk-Jan C. Binnema 2022-01-30 14:28:30 +02:00
  • cc3be78dc5 mu4e-main: use mu4e~headers-jump-to-maildir Dirk-Jan C. Binnema 2022-01-29 19:53:37 +02:00
  • b8e696000f mu4e-main: fix jump-to-maildir typo Dirk-Jan C. Binnema 2022-01-29 15:55:51 +02:00
  • 3138b2d1a9 mu-find.1: Document correct return value Dirk-Jan C. Binnema 2022-01-29 10:41:05 +02:00
  • 20568cba70 mu4e-view: open tmp files read-only Dirk-Jan C. Binnema 2022-01-24 18:57:45 +02:00
  • de3c9a25e8 mu4e.texi: improve mu4e-mailing-list-patterns example Dirk-Jan C. Binnema 2022-01-23 14:22:32 +02:00
  • a30cc3d9e9 NEWS.org: update Dirk-Jan C. Binnema 2022-01-23 14:22:10 +02:00
  • a4707afe12 mu4e: cleanups and flycheck fixes Dirk-Jan C. Binnema 2022-01-23 10:29:45 +02:00
  • 3e3d26be8f clang-format: tweaks Dirk-Jan C. Binnema 2022-01-23 10:29:22 +02:00
  • 74437b6374 mu4e-headers: Add mu4e-headers-thread-mark-as-orphan option Marcelo Henrique Cerri 2022-01-19 16:55:28 -03:00
  • aa2ba0f102 build: bump version to 1.7.6 Dirk-Jan C. Binnema 2022-01-18 16:42:22 +02:00
  • a6b996d00e search: restore jump-to-message Dirk-Jan C. Binnema 2022-01-18 16:58:50 +02:00
  • f035c801bb store: save contacts more often Dirk-Jan C. Binnema 2022-01-15 15:12:38 +02:00
  • ca4651a891 mu-contacts: add dirty() Dirk-Jan C. Binnema 2022-01-15 15:11:26 +02:00
  • be4fc67584 mu-cfind: don't show error when there are no matches Dirk-Jan C. Binnema 2022-01-15 12:45:40 +02:00
  • 244e10bf7d clang-format: tweak Dirk-Jan C. Binnema 2022-01-15 12:46:18 +02:00
  • e5ead56b2a mu4e-view: fix flycheck warnings Dirk-Jan C. Binnema 2022-01-15 11:35:47 +02:00
  • a4e5e3adf5 mu4e: attempt to delete loading window upon mu4e-error Dirk-Jan C. Binnema 2022-01-15 10:44:03 +02:00
  • dfe592ac4f mu-server: check for message readability Dirk-Jan C. Binnema 2022-01-15 10:21:32 +02:00
  • 904214ba17 mu4e-view: double-check message file exists Dirk-Jan C. Binnema 2022-01-15 10:19:31 +02:00
  • ddba5bf01a meson.build: cosmetic Dirk-Jan C. Binnema 2022-01-14 17:11:08 +02:00
  • cbb2734078 mu-cmd-index: cosmetic Dirk-Jan C. Binnema 2022-01-14 17:10:56 +02:00
  • 08dc66a525 mu-utils: Fix compiler warning Dirk-Jan C. Binnema 2022-01-14 17:10:16 +02:00
  • b072b4a57e mu4e-view: Add defcustom mu4e-view-open-program Dirk-Jan C. Binnema 2022-01-12 22:32:21 +02:00
  • 324b6f5022 mu4e-view: experiment xwidget support Dirk-Jan C. Binnema 2022-01-10 22:07:06 +02:00
  • 42d5cde612 mu4e-view: catch epg error Dirk-Jan C. Binnema 2022-01-09 14:08:24 +02:00
  • ec41585dab mu-msg-file: check for top-level s/mime Dirk-Jan C. Binnema 2022-01-09 11:36:39 +02:00
  • 4df94b0c86 mu-init: update manpage Dirk-Jan C. Binnema 2022-01-09 10:25:25 +02:00
  • bbf55256e5 mu4e-view: add massage toggle for text filling Dirk-Jan C. Binnema 2021-12-25 11:01:33 +02:00
  • 8704101afc mu4e-folders: fix typo in docstring Dirk-Jan C. Binnema 2021-12-19 23:15:22 +02:00
  • 8dcdd0a815 mu4e-view: add toggle to show all mime-parts Dirk-Jan C. Binnema 2021-12-19 23:12:59 +02:00
  • d389dbb5b3 config: minor cleanup Dirk-Jan C. Binnema 2021-12-18 15:26:05 +02:00
  • e45fc92036 Merge pull request #2191 from tsdh/eldoc-support Dirk-Jan C. Binnema 2021-12-19 22:52:35 +02:00
  • 4f02702510 store: add catch blocks for dirstamp/set_dirstamp Dirk-Jan C. Binnema 2021-12-18 15:21:48 +02:00
  • abd0abf5c8 mu-msg-file: don't insist on absolute path Dirk-Jan C. Binnema 2021-11-23 21:09:39 +02:00
  • c14ffa2918 Add eldoc support in headers views Tassilo Horn 2021-12-15 21:21:41 +01:00
  • 9d4326e3ce Merge pull request #2180 from wavexx/ignore_old_elc Dirk-Jan C. Binnema 2021-12-15 20:22:36 +02:00
  • e1022fe9b1 Assign list-buffers-directory to search query Daniel Nagy 2021-12-02 11:17:53 +01:00
  • 3001c7832d tests: add unit test for cjk handling Dirk-Jan C. Binnema 2021-11-22 22:17:46 +02:00
  • e8719889d8 clang-format: tweaks Dirk-Jan C. Binnema 2021-11-22 21:54:03 +02:00
  • 0ade4ecfa7 indexer: fix race condition Dirk-Jan C. Binnema 2021-11-22 21:52:01 +02:00
  • 86f88299e7 Ignore existing compiled files when byte-compiling Yuri D'Elia 2021-11-13 14:35:07 +01:00
  • d0bb0f215a man: update mu-index (.noupdate) Dirk-Jan C. Binnema 2021-11-13 07:58:49 +02:00
  • f71c05805c build: Add some Xapian deps Dirk-Jan C. Binnema 2021-11-12 23:11:45 +02:00
  • 113a831641 mu4e: add (from|to)nameoraddress properties for links Dirk-Jan C. Binnema 2021-11-12 23:05:08 +02:00